From my point of view, the difference between PS4 and XBox 1 is fuck all. They both do pretty much the same thing, and the graphics/processing difference is only apparent to game nerds that site there obsessing over every tiny little minute detail, that most average people won't ever notice.
The only distinct difference that should really affect your choice, is whether there are any console exclusive game series' that you/your kids prefer. i.e. Halo is only on Xbox. Apart from that, the majority of the big titles are available across both consoles.
I used to be a loyal Playstation owner (ps1/ps2) but I ended up buying a 360 because it was about $150 cheaper than the PS3 at the time, and the games I wanted to get were not exclusive to either console. That was several years ago, and I'm still happy with my choice.
As above, I've heard Wii U is great. And, IMO, Nintendo has always been the best console for kids/families due to their range of games and the durability/simplicity of their devices.
